Pastor Kevin Kang and other faith leaders from various religious backgrounds in southern California are protesting against recent ICE raids targeting undocumented immigrants, including vendors near Kang's church. Kang encourages his congregation to advocate for vulnerable communities, reflecting on the scripture's call to defend those in need. Eddie Anderson, another pastor, highlights the role of religious leaders in preventing violence at protests and emphasizes the necessity of voicing opposition against injustices, asserting that failing to act means accepting that some people are viewed as disposable.
